Home insurance agents in Bristol Pennsylvania help homeowners find coverage that meets state requirements and protects against local risks like flooding from the Delaware River. Pennsylvania law does not require homeowners insurance but mortgage lenders usually do. An agent can explain policy options and help you choose the right amount of dwelling and liability coverage.

What Does a Home Insurance Agent in Bristol Cost?

The average cost of homeowners insurance in Pennsylvania is around 1,200 to 1,500 dollars per year for a typical policy. In Bristol, rates may be higher due to flood exposure and older housing stock. Factors like your homes age, roof condition, and claims history affect your premium. This is general information and not insurance advice.

What does a home insurance agent in Bristol do?
A home insurance agent helps you compare policies from different insurers. They explain coverage types like dwelling, personal property, and liability. They also advise on additional coverages for flood or sewer backup common in Bucks County.
Do I need flood insurance in Bristol Pennsylvania?
Standard home policies do not cover flood damage. Bristol is near the Delaware River so flood risk is higher. Your agent can help you obtain a separate flood policy through the National Flood Insurance Program or a private carrier.
How do Pennsylvania insurance laws affect my home policy?
Pennsylvania requires insurers to offer replacement cost coverage for dwelling losses. The state also has a 12-month statute of limitations for filing a lawsuit after a denied claim. Your agent can explain these rules when you buy a policy.
